Output 96e3de9338aef3c5a4c413f26dd0521fbd7d69741659a70de4c7e79dcdaa8be7:4

value
21027484
script pubkey
OP_0 OP_PUSHBYTES_20 bc33f2e2f52a28608b830bac54bc84c12e84388c
address
bc1qhsel9ch49g5xpzurpwk9f0yycyhggwyvau72x3
transaction
96e3de9338aef3c5a4c413f26dd0521fbd7d69741659a70de4c7e79dcdaa8be7
spent
true